Transaction 04d133ed359142e61f695b21a42eb292b72d5976c85a33a72e181aed703cec88
1 Input
1 Output
-
04d133ed359142e61f695b21a42eb292b72d5976c85a33a72e181aed703cec88:0
- value
- 865976
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eff31ba52e548435768e04727ccd866817613ca6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NsjjHdRBRm1VnvwHSEfibVJKzurjU29zY